Joe
Clean, safe, but very rundown
It is located right off of I-44 as advertised. If someone was travelling through Tulsa it would be a great spot to pull off for the night- because it's inexpensive and serves the purpose of a place to sleep and a quick bowl of cereal in the morning. If I were returning to Tulsa with my family for a few days, I would definitely stay somewhere that was more family friendly. It's a trucker's dream hotel.

jennafrance
Great room, great price, great security
The hotel was nice especially for the price. Everything was clean. I liked the security cameras in the hallways and parking lot. It really helped to have a sense of security especially since my car has been broken into twice at other hotels. They had a safe in the room and a fridge and microwave which I will consider usefull on future trips with the kids. The bed was comfortable and the ac worked great. I have nothing to complain about except the water pressure in the tub. It took a long time to run a bath. Everything was very clean and the staff was friendly. They have internet access on site and free breakfast. I was surprised they serve breakfast later than most hotels so that is nice. I would definately stay here again.

pbsmoker
Days Inn lung cancer
I paid extra for a non-smoking room. There was no point because the entire hotel to include the hallways all stunk like smoke! The hotel is right off the highway, so expect road noise. There isnt much nearby as far as food goes. Stay at one of the casinos nearby, you would be way better off!
